The National Monuments Service's description

Road bridge (original Wth 5.8m; long axis E-W) spanning the Owbeg River. Built of random rubble. Single segmental arch with roughly shaped voussoirs spans river. Two segmental dry arches, with roughly shaped voussoirs, on floodplain to the W. Two pointed cut-waters on upstream (N) side of piers rise to height of arches. The bridge has recently been extended on the downstream side. The surviving parapet wall has vertical stone coping.
